Self-Contained Water and Oil Separator
Abstract
A system and method for the separation of oil and water. Contaminated water is introduced into a settling and separating bowl through an inlet pipe. The contaminants float to the top and are recovered by a weir skimmer. The weir skimmer is fluidly connected to a recovered oil tank which receives the recovered oil. An oil separator filter belt is located in the separating bowl and separates the bowl into two segments: an upstream end on the side closest to the inlet and a downstream end on the opposite side of the inlet of the belt. The oil separator filter belt aggregates entrapped and entrained oil and other contaminants.

1 . A system for the separation of water and contaminants, said system comprising:
an inlet pipe which directs contaminated water to a bowl; a weir skimmer located within said bowl, wherein said weir skimmer recovers contaminants which float atop the contaminated water; a filter belt located within said bowl, wherein said filter belt aggregates entrained contaminants; an outlet pipe which directs cleaned water out of said bowl; and wherein said filter belt divides the bowl into an upstream end upstream from said filter belt and a downstream end downstream from said filter belt, wherein said inlet pipe is located in said upstream end, and wherein said outlet pipe is located in said downstream end.
2 . The system of claim further comprising an air blade.
3 . The system of claim 1 wherein the weir skimmer is fluidly connected to a recovered oil tank such that recovered oil can be directed to said recovered oil tank.
4 . The system of claim 1 wherein between about 5 and 50 gallons per minute of contaminated water are introduced into the system through said inlet pipe.
5 . The system of claim 1 wherein said contaminated water comprises hydrocarbons in an amount greater than 250,000 ppm.
6 . The system of claim 1 wherein said weir skimmer is a floating weir skimmer, and wherein said skimmer is coupled to at least one float.

The system of claim 6 wherein the height of said skimmer relative to a water level is adjustable, and wherein a phrase break forms in a layer atop said contaminated water in said bowl, said wherein said skimmer is located at a height relative to said phase break such that the top layer of the phase break is recovered by said weir.
8 . The system of claim 1 wherein water must pass through said filter belt before said water can advance to the downstream segment.
9 . The system of claim 1 wherein said filter comprises an oil phobic material.
10 . The system of claim 1 wherein said filter comprises a screen material.
11 . The system of claim 1 wherein said filter further comprises a membrane.
12 . The system of claim 11 wherein said membrane prevents a majority of oil, grease, and paraffin from passing through said filter.
13 . The system of claim 11 wherein said membrane allows water to pass but separates oil particles.
